Many people like to feed old bread to ducks. What’s so bad about that?
Unfortunately, there are few problems with this activity. First, ducks aren’t meant to eat bread. It isn’t good for them. They are meant to eat other things from their natural habitat, such as plants and bugs.
Second, this activity leads to pollution. Some bread will sink to the bottom of the water before the ducks can eat it. The leftover bread rots. This brings pests and diseases into the water where the ducks live.
Third, this changes the ducks’ behavior. Ducks who are fed by humans may forget how to find their own food. This makes them helpless in the wild.
If you want to help ducks in your area, there are other activities you can try. Pick up any trash you see near a duck pond. Drive with caution so that ducks can cross the street safely. If you have a cat, keep it inside so that it won’t hunt ducks for fun.
There are many ways to be kind to ducks. But please, don’t feed them bread.
